About the building

George E. Edgecomb Courthouse is the main courthouse for the 13th Judicial Circuit of Florida, located in downtown Tampa. It handles most family and civil cases in Hillsborough County. The 332,000 square feet building was opened in January 2004 and cost $42.9 million to construct.

History

The building is named after George E. Edgecomb, the first African American judge of Hillsborough County. A bust of Edgecomb is located in the lobby, and a statue of Lady Justice stands outside the entrance.
